파일과 테이블 사이의 정보교환을 할 수 있는 명령어.
[Synopsis]
COPY [ BINARY ] table [ WITH OIDS ]
FROM { 'filename' | stdin }
[ [ USING ] DELIMITERS 'delimiter' ]
[ WITH NULL AS 'null_string' ]
COPY [ BINARY ] table [ WITH OIDS ]
TO { 'filename' | stdout }
[ [ USING ] DELIMITERS 'delimiter' ]
[ WITH NULL AS 'null_string' ]
FROM { 'filename' | stdin }
[ [ USING ] DELIMITERS 'delimiter' ]
[ WITH NULL AS 'null_string' ]
COPY [ BINARY ] table [ WITH OIDS ]
TO { 'filename' | stdout }
[ [ USING ] DELIMITERS 'delimiter' ]
[ WITH NULL AS 'null_string' ]
employees 테이블의 내용을 /tmp/employee_data 파일로 COPY. 각 필드값에 대한 구분자는 '|'
COPY employees TO '/tmp/employee_data' USING DELIMITERS '|';
/tmp/publisher_data 파일의 내용을 publisher 테이블로 COPY
COPY publishers FROM '/tmp/publisher_data';
'DataBase' 카테고리의 다른 글
[PostgreSQL] 문자열을 배열로 나눠 검색 (0) | 2009.05.27 |
---|---|
[PostgreSQL] 인코딩을 UTF-8 로 할 때. (0) | 2009.05.25 |
PosgreSQL - 상속 (0) | 2009.05.02 |
PostgreSQL - FOREIGN KEY (0) | 2009.05.02 |
PostgreSQL - VIEW (0) | 2009.05.02 |